Abstract

A model is presented to simulate the behaviour of an axisymmetric volatile liquid droplet impacting on a hot solid surface in the film boiling region. A volume of fluid (VOF) algorithm is used to model the gross deformation of the droplet. This algorithm is coupled to a separate one-dimensional algorithm used to model fluid flow within the viscous vapour layer existing between the droplet and solid surface. Heat transfer within the solid, liquid and vapour phases is solved, and a kinetic theory treatment is used to calculate conditions existing at the non-equilibrium interfaces of the vapour layer.
